This is called “staking the lot”.Surveying and staking is an important function, as houses have been placed in violation of certain setbacks or restrictions, and if a surveyor does this, he or she is responsible for the expense of making corrections if mistakes are made.I have seen surveyors who made errors have to pay for rebuilding a foundation. Summary: The first step in building a new home is the placement or position of the house on the building site.The number one problem that occurs when building a new home is the incorrect placement of the house on the lot.STEP 1: Building a House Step by Step-Land Survey and Placement of Your Home (1-3 hours)Since this will be, most likely, the first house you have built, I recommend that you have a registered land surveyor, using wooden stakes, stake the corners and the lot lines of the building site and the desired position of the house on the building site.
